# Self‑Correcting LangGraph Agent
|
||||
|
||||
This repository contains a minimal example of a **self‑correcting agent** built with
|
||||
[LangGraph](https://langchain-ai.github.io/langgraph/) and
|
||||
[LangChain](https://langchain.com/). The agent:
|
||||
## Overview
|
||||
|
||||
1. **Receives a natural‑language task** from the user.
|
||||
2. **Executes the task** via an *unreliable* tool that fails 30 % of the time.
|
||||
3. **Asks an LLM** (OpenAI GPT‑4o‑mini) to judge whether the result is correct.
|
||||
4. **Retries automatically** until the judge says *success* or the maximum number
|
||||
of attempts is reached.

## How It Works
|
||||
|
||||
1. **Start** – The graph begins at `execute_task`.
|
||||
2. **Execute** – The tool runs. If it throws an exception, the state status becomes `failed`.
|
||||
3. **Check attempts** – If the number of attempts is >= `max_attempts`, the graph ends with status `max_attempts`.
|
||||
4. **Verify** – The LLM judges the result. If the verdict is `success`, the graph ends. If `failed`, it goes to `handle_error`.
|
||||
5. **Retry** – `handle_error` clears the error and sets status to `pending`, then the graph loops back to `execute_task`.
